
Tan Neau engineered robust enhancements for the rancher/fleet repository, focusing on secure Git authentication, multi-cluster resource management, and automated deployment reliability. Leveraging Go and YAML, Tan refactored core controllers to support GitHub Apps and token-based authentication, introduced experimental downstream resource copying, and improved bundle exclusion logic with globbing and .fleetignore support. Their work streamlined CI/CD pipelines, strengthened error handling, and increased observability by refining status reporting and error taxonomy. Through careful code organization and comprehensive end-to-end testing, Tan delivered scalable, maintainable solutions that improved operational safety and deployment consistency across Kubernetes environments, demonstrating depth in backend and DevOps engineering.

October 2025: Rancher Fleet delivered a set of security, reliability, and observability enhancements across the repo, focusing on Git operations, secret management, multi-cluster resource handling, and CI/test reliability. The month prioritized secure and flexible repository access, robust bundle management, and stronger operational signals to accelerate safe releases.
October 2025: Rancher Fleet delivered a set of security, reliability, and observability enhancements across the repo, focusing on Git operations, secret management, multi-cluster resource handling, and CI/test reliability. The month prioritized secure and flexible repository access, robust bundle management, and stronger operational signals to accelerate safe releases.
September 2025 performance highlights: delivered stability and reliability improvements across Fleet and related docs, enabling faster delivery cycles and higher confidence in upgrades and restores. Strengthened CI, testing, and error visibility, while clarifying Fleet-specific backup/restore guidance for operators.
September 2025 performance highlights: delivered stability and reliability improvements across Fleet and related docs, enabling faster delivery cycles and higher confidence in upgrades and restores. Strengthened CI, testing, and error visibility, while clarifying Fleet-specific backup/restore guidance for operators.
August 2025 – Rancher Fleet: Delivered enhancements to OCI-based chart management (semver constraints, highest-tag selection, and OCI registry polling via HelmOps) and hardened bundle resource filtering (robust values-file exclusion by name or directory prefix). These changes increase deployment predictability, reduce the risk of outdated or unintended resources, and strengthen bundle governance across fleet.yaml locations.
August 2025 – Rancher Fleet: Delivered enhancements to OCI-based chart management (semver constraints, highest-tag selection, and OCI registry polling via HelmOps) and hardened bundle resource filtering (robust values-file exclusion by name or directory prefix). These changes increase deployment predictability, reduce the risk of outdated or unintended resources, and strengthen bundle governance across fleet.yaml locations.
July 2025: Focused delivery of reliability, observability, and automation enhancements in Rancher Fleet, alongside CI stability improvements and deployment readiness enhancements. Implemented HelmOp integration into cluster status reporting, improved readiness and health signals for deployments, and added graceful shutdown handling and namespace alignment to Fleet agent. Expanded automation around known-hosts updates and secret credential handling with deterministic behavior. These efforts reduce deploy risk, improve operational visibility, and enable smoother cross-branch release management.
July 2025: Focused delivery of reliability, observability, and automation enhancements in Rancher Fleet, alongside CI stability improvements and deployment readiness enhancements. Implemented HelmOp integration into cluster status reporting, improved readiness and health signals for deployments, and added graceful shutdown handling and namespace alignment to Fleet agent. Expanded automation around known-hosts updates and secret credential handling with deterministic behavior. These efforts reduce deploy risk, improve operational visibility, and enable smoother cross-branch release management.
June 2025 monthly summary for rancher/fleet focused on delivering robust HelmOps enhancements, security hardening, and improved reliability. The work accelerates GitOps-driven deployments, reduces misconfigurations, and improves operational visibility while expanding automatic version checks and safer deployment practices.
June 2025 monthly summary for rancher/fleet focused on delivering robust HelmOps enhancements, security hardening, and improved reliability. The work accelerates GitOps-driven deployments, reduces misconfigurations, and improves operational visibility while expanding automatic version checks and safer deployment practices.
May 2025 monthly summary for rancher/fleet. The Fleet team delivered a set of high-impact features, introduced targeted improvements in secret management, reorganized deployment APIs for clarity and efficiency, automated operational tasks across release branches, and strengthened testing reliability. The work enhances multi-cluster deployment consistency, security posture, and data integrity while accelerating delivery cycles.
May 2025 monthly summary for rancher/fleet. The Fleet team delivered a set of high-impact features, introduced targeted improvements in secret management, reorganized deployment APIs for clarity and efficiency, automated operational tasks across release branches, and strengthened testing reliability. The work enhances multi-cluster deployment consistency, security posture, and data integrity while accelerating delivery cycles.
April 2025 performance summary for rancher/fleet: Delivered key features and reliability improvements, fixed critical validation and security issues, and refined maintenance workflows. The work focused on increasing release reliability, security hardening, and reducing unnecessary operations, enabling faster, safer deployments with improved observability.
April 2025 performance summary for rancher/fleet: Delivered key features and reliability improvements, fixed critical validation and security issues, and refined maintenance workflows. The work focused on increasing release reliability, security hardening, and reducing unnecessary operations, enabling faster, safer deployments with improved observability.
March 2025 monthly summary for rancher/fleet. Focused on reliability, maintainability, and developer productivity. Delivered features and improvements that improved secret handling, test robustness, and deployment status checks, along with a key bug fix. Resulted in more reliable GitRepo CA bundle secret detection, faster and more stable end-to-end tests, and elimination of false alerts in bundle deployment status checks. Notable work includes performance improvements for E2E tests, modernization of drift detection handling, and documentation/code quality improvements to support contributor onboarding. Technologies demonstrated include Go-based Kubernetes controllers, CI/test automation, linting, and documentation hygiene.
March 2025 monthly summary for rancher/fleet. Focused on reliability, maintainability, and developer productivity. Delivered features and improvements that improved secret handling, test robustness, and deployment status checks, along with a key bug fix. Resulted in more reliable GitRepo CA bundle secret detection, faster and more stable end-to-end tests, and elimination of false alerts in bundle deployment status checks. Notable work includes performance improvements for E2E tests, modernization of drift detection handling, and documentation/code quality improvements to support contributor onboarding. Technologies demonstrated include Go-based Kubernetes controllers, CI/test automation, linting, and documentation hygiene.
February 2025 monthly summary for rancher/fleet: Delivered key reliability and performance improvements across uninstall workflows, CA management, and CI/test infrastructure. Key outcomes include: (1) Uninstall reliability improvement for content resources by removing finalizers during Fleet uninstall to prevent hangs and enable reliable uninstall/reinstall workflows; (2) CA Bundle Fallback for Git and Helm: use Rancher-configured CA bundles as fallback when custom CA bundles are not provided, with a new cert package to extract CA bundle info and updates to clients and end-to-end tests; (3) CI and Integration Test Stability Improvements: increased nightly CI CPU to 16 cores, higher integration test worker counts, and refined non-ready bundle error reporting for faster debugging. Overall, these changes reduce downtime, improve security posture, and accelerate deployment cycles.
February 2025 monthly summary for rancher/fleet: Delivered key reliability and performance improvements across uninstall workflows, CA management, and CI/test infrastructure. Key outcomes include: (1) Uninstall reliability improvement for content resources by removing finalizers during Fleet uninstall to prevent hangs and enable reliable uninstall/reinstall workflows; (2) CA Bundle Fallback for Git and Helm: use Rancher-configured CA bundles as fallback when custom CA bundles are not provided, with a new cert package to extract CA bundle info and updates to clients and end-to-end tests; (3) CI and Integration Test Stability Improvements: increased nightly CI CPU to 16 cores, higher integration test worker counts, and refined non-ready bundle error reporting for faster debugging. Overall, these changes reduce downtime, improve security posture, and accelerate deployment cycles.
January 2025 monthly summary for rancher/fleet focused on CI reliability and Kubernetes deployment robustness. Delivered three key improvements that reduce pipeline flakiness and enable safer deployments across diverse environments. 1) CI: Robust handling of OCI-registry-dependent tests in nightly workflow by deferring tests until the OCI registry is available, reducing early-nightly failures (Commit: 3554b1fd5d0e7827d92506e6775797b19df266e4). 2) CI: Reliable yq installation across environments by updating install methods to ensure yq is available on all runners; this included skipping the snap dependency for yq on self-hosted runners and installing snapd via apt (Commits: edb4925ffaec98fa330f6e9bfc509397c4926cf0, 9a7eeb76d5c8de3d41304a29848f5ef2f08b59fd). 3) Kubernetes / Fleet: Propagate tolerations to jobs to support tainted nodes, enabling Fleet charts installation on tainted clusters (Commit: 817b98c8a5a5e479ad573d631a6f200ef6ff2caf). Impact and accomplishments: Increased CI reliability, faster feedback loops, and more robust Fleet deployments in tainted and varied cluster environments. Demonstrated skills in CI/CD orchestration, cross-environment tooling (yq), and Kubernetes workload tuning for reliability.
January 2025 monthly summary for rancher/fleet focused on CI reliability and Kubernetes deployment robustness. Delivered three key improvements that reduce pipeline flakiness and enable safer deployments across diverse environments. 1) CI: Robust handling of OCI-registry-dependent tests in nightly workflow by deferring tests until the OCI registry is available, reducing early-nightly failures (Commit: 3554b1fd5d0e7827d92506e6775797b19df266e4). 2) CI: Reliable yq installation across environments by updating install methods to ensure yq is available on all runners; this included skipping the snap dependency for yq on self-hosted runners and installing snapd via apt (Commits: edb4925ffaec98fa330f6e9bfc509397c4926cf0, 9a7eeb76d5c8de3d41304a29848f5ef2f08b59fd). 3) Kubernetes / Fleet: Propagate tolerations to jobs to support tainted nodes, enabling Fleet charts installation on tainted clusters (Commit: 817b98c8a5a5e479ad573d631a6f200ef6ff2caf). Impact and accomplishments: Increased CI reliability, faster feedback loops, and more robust Fleet deployments in tainted and varied cluster environments. Demonstrated skills in CI/CD orchestration, cross-environment tooling (yq), and Kubernetes workload tuning for reliability.
December 2024 monthly summary for rancher/fleet: Delivered configurability for worker counts across fleet controllers and agents, enabling scalable concurrency. Exposed agent worker counts in the fleet chart and added chart-level configuration for bundledeployment and drift reconcilers, while removing unused cleanup container env vars. Improved CI reliability by deterministically deriving the registered cluster name for Fleet tests via dynamic kubectl lookup. Implemented conditional job cleanup so the cleanup cron runs only when migrations.gitrepoJobsCleanup and gitops.enabled are both true, preventing unnecessary cleanup when GitOps is disabled. Enhanced fleet-agent chart validation messages to clearly guide users on namespace or release name requirements, reducing installation issues. Overall impact: better scalability, reliability, and UX with clear guidance for operators. Technologies/skills demonstrated: Kubernetes fleet architecture, Helm chart configuration, CI reliability strategies, kubectl scripting, and conditional feature flag handling.
December 2024 monthly summary for rancher/fleet: Delivered configurability for worker counts across fleet controllers and agents, enabling scalable concurrency. Exposed agent worker counts in the fleet chart and added chart-level configuration for bundledeployment and drift reconcilers, while removing unused cleanup container env vars. Improved CI reliability by deterministically deriving the registered cluster name for Fleet tests via dynamic kubectl lookup. Implemented conditional job cleanup so the cleanup cron runs only when migrations.gitrepoJobsCleanup and gitops.enabled are both true, preventing unnecessary cleanup when GitOps is disabled. Enhanced fleet-agent chart validation messages to clearly guide users on namespace or release name requirements, reducing installation issues. Overall impact: better scalability, reliability, and UX with clear guidance for operators. Technologies/skills demonstrated: Kubernetes fleet architecture, Helm chart configuration, CI reliability strategies, kubectl scripting, and conditional feature flag handling.
Month: 2024-11 — Performance highlights across rancher-docs and fleet with a focus on business value, reliability, and developer agility. Key outcomes include clearer, more professional documentation; stabilized Fleet behavior by addressing defaults in target customization; cleanup that improves lint health; streamlined release workflows; and more robust test-release/version resolution and end-to-end testing. These changes reduce operational risk, shorten release cycles, and elevate overall platform quality.
Month: 2024-11 — Performance highlights across rancher-docs and fleet with a focus on business value, reliability, and developer agility. Key outcomes include clearer, more professional documentation; stabilized Fleet behavior by addressing defaults in target customization; cleanup that improves lint health; streamlined release workflows; and more robust test-release/version resolution and end-to-end testing. These changes reduce operational risk, shorten release cycles, and elevate overall platform quality.
Concluded October 2024 with a focus on stabilizing CI/CD for Fleet, improving status reconciliation, and enhancing docs clarity. Delivered features to increase test reliability, fixed concurrency in drift status updates, and updated testing/docs to reduce onboarding and support queries. These changes improve developer feedback loops, release confidence, and end-user visibility into search behaviors.
Concluded October 2024 with a focus on stabilizing CI/CD for Fleet, improving status reconciliation, and enhancing docs clarity. Delivered features to increase test reliability, fixed concurrency in drift status updates, and updated testing/docs to reduce onboarding and support queries. These changes improve developer feedback loops, release confidence, and end-user visibility into search behaviors.
Overview of all repositories you've contributed to across your timeline